只上了6节课,老师就要让交编程作业,Java Web的,题目:利用Jsp ,Servlet技术,编写一个客户信息查询的
4个回答
展开全部
so easy
1、myeclipse建立一个web project,创建一个jsp,一个servlet,一个service类,名字分别为:
test.jsp(利用表单form submit发送请求), TestServlet.java(接收jsp表单请求), Service.java(连接数据库查询)
2、test.jsp中写:
<body>
This is my JSP page. <br>
<form action="<%=path %>/servlet/TestServlet" method="get">
名字: <input type="text" name="username"><br/>
密码:<input type="password" name="pass"><br/>
<input type="submit">
</form>
</body>
2.TestServlet的doGet中这样写:
public void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
response.setContentType("text/html");
String name = request.getParameter("username");
String pass = request.getParameter("pass");
System.out.println(name);
//调用service类中的查询方法,返回用户详细资料对象
CustomerInfo cc = new Service().queryInfo(name,pass);//这个查询数据库的自己写
request.setAttribute("age",“年龄”);//jsp页面直接用el表达式拿出来,这么写:<c:out value="${age}" />
request.setAttribute("address",“地址”); //同上
1、myeclipse建立一个web project,创建一个jsp,一个servlet,一个service类,名字分别为:
test.jsp(利用表单form submit发送请求), TestServlet.java(接收jsp表单请求), Service.java(连接数据库查询)
2、test.jsp中写:
<body>
This is my JSP page. <br>
<form action="<%=path %>/servlet/TestServlet" method="get">
名字: <input type="text" name="username"><br/>
密码:<input type="password" name="pass"><br/>
<input type="submit">
</form>
</body>
2.TestServlet的doGet中这样写:
public void doGet(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
response.setContentType("text/html");
String name = request.getParameter("username");
String pass = request.getParameter("pass");
System.out.println(name);
//调用service类中的查询方法,返回用户详细资料对象
CustomerInfo cc = new Service().queryInfo(name,pass);//这个查询数据库的自己写
request.setAttribute("age",“年龄”);//jsp页面直接用el表达式拿出来,这么写:<c:out value="${age}" />
request.setAttribute("address",“地址”); //同上
展开全部
用mvc么,如果用的话你的service就提供一个通过用户名查询用户信息的方法。然后DAO层就是一个简单的sql查询方法。很简单
追问
很乐意请教您,只是周末就要交作业了,你能再具体告诉我怎么做吗?
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2012-05-03 · 知道合伙人数码行家
关注
展开全部
不是吧!就是要自己学,还是问你的朋友吧!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
网上找,图书馆里面的书随便一本web的都有类似案例
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询